Rotten floor repair in West Bend plays a crucial role in preventing further structural damage and keeping living spaces safe. Moisture, mold, or unnoticed leaks can all lead to deteriorating wood and subflooring. Without timely repair, what starts as a soft spot can quickly evolve into a dangerous structural hazard. Hiring a professional ensures not only the visible issue is fixed but that any underlying cause is properly identified and corrected. Addressing these problems early helps homeowners in West Bend avoid larger, more expensive repairs down the road.

🚫 Reduces Health Risks from Mold
Rotten flooring often comes with mold growth, which poses serious health risks. Professional repair eliminates moldy material and addresses moisture sources, supporting better indoor air quality. This is especially helpful for those with allergies or respiratory sensitivities.
🔎 Uncovers Hidden Damage
Floor rot is sometimes just the tip of the iceberg. During repairs, professionals may find plumbing leaks, poor insulation, or termite damage. Fixing these problems early prevents additional harm and unexpected expenses.
👣 Improves Walking Comfort
Rotten sections of floor can feel soft, unstable, or make noise underfoot. Repair brings back smoothness and comfort, creating a safer, more enjoyable surface for daily use. It also ensures furniture and appliances remain level and supported.
💡 Prevents Recurring Damage
Repairing rot correctly involves addressing the root cause, such as poor ventilation or standing water. Long-term fixes are more effective when they solve the full problem, not just the visible symptoms. This helps your flooring last longer with less maintenance.
